A Symphony of Blue: Design and Aesthetics
The beauty of the Rolex Datejust 31 blue lies in its understated elegance. The 31mm Oyster case, perfectly proportioned for a variety of wrists, is a testament to Rolex's commitment to classic watchmaking. The smooth bezel, often crafted from polished Oystersteel, complements the luxurious dial, which is the star of the show. The deep blue dial, available in various finishes from sunburst to textured, offers a captivating depth that shifts subtly in different lighting conditions. This deep blue hue is often described as a rich sapphire or a captivating midnight blue, adding a touch of mystery and sophistication.
The iconic Cyclops lens over the date window at 3 o'clock is a hallmark of the Datejust, providing effortless readability of the date. The hands, often crafted from 18k gold, provide a beautiful contrast against the blue dial, enhancing the overall aesthetic balance. The bracelet, typically an Oyster bracelet, is equally important to the overall feel of the watch. The meticulously crafted links, with their comfortable fit and secure clasp, provide both durability and a sense of luxurious comfort.
Variations and Options:
While the blue dial is a constant, the Rolex Datejust 31 offers a range of variations to suit individual preferences. These include:
* Oystersteel: The most common material for the case and bracelet, offering excellent durability and resistance to scratches. This is often the most accessible price point within the Datejust 31 range.
* Two-Tone: Combining Oystersteel with 18k yellow or Everose gold, these models offer a blend of robustness and luxurious appeal. The gold accents on the bezel, indices, and hands add a touch of opulence.
* Precious Metals: High-end versions are available in 18k yellow gold, 18k white gold, or 18k Everose gold, offering a truly luxurious feel and exceptional weight. These versions often feature diamond-set bezels or dials, pushing the price into a significantly higher bracket.
* Dial Variations: While the blue dial is the focus here, other dial colours and finishes are available, including silver, white, champagne, and various other shades, each offering a unique aesthetic.
